Such options can come in any QP state, so add in/out fields to set and query ECE options. OUT fields: * create_qp()/create_dct() - default ECE options for that type of QP. * modify_qp() - enabled ECE options after QP state transition. IN fields: * create_qp()/create_dct() - create QP with this ECE option. * modify_qp() - requested options. For unconnected QPs, the FW will return an error if ECE is already configured with any options that not equal to previously set.
